The Nursing Exam 2026 is conducted for aspiring nurses across India, with various exams held by different institutions for recruitment and educational purposes. These exams include BSc Nursing, ANM, GNM, RRB Staff Nurse, AIIMS NORCET, and NHM-CHO. Below are the key details for each exam:
|
Nursing 2026 Exams Details |
||
|
Nursing Exam |
Purpose |
Subjects Focus |
|
BSc Nursing (UG) Exam 2026 |
Admission into BSc Nursing programs in top institutions like AIIMS. |
Anatomy, Physiology, Nursing Foundation, Medical-Surgical Nursing. |
|
ANM (Auxiliary Nurse Midwife) Exam 2026 |
For candidates pursuing a career as auxiliary nurses. |
Basic nursing skills, Maternal and Child healthcare. |
|
GNM (General Nursing and Midwifery) Exam 2026 |
For those aiming to become general nurses and midwives. |
Maternal care, Child health, Community nursing, and a range of healthcare topics. |
|
RRB Staff Nurse Exam 2026 |
Conducted by the Railway Recruitment Board for Indian Railways nursing posts. |
Nursing theory, Medical-surgical nursing, Healthcare practices. |
|
AIIMS NORCET Exam 2026 |
AIIMS recruitment for nursing posts through the National Online Recruitment Common Eligibility Test (NORCET). |
Medical-surgical nursing, Pediatric nursing, Obstetrics, Gynecology. |
|
NHM-CHO Exam 2026 |
For Community Health Officer roles under the National Health Mission. |
Community health practices, Basic healthcare services, Public health management. |
